Toilet training is commonly delayed in Autism spectrum disorders (ASD). Dalrymple and Ruble (1992) surveyed 100 parents of clients with ASD (mean age = 19.5 years) and reported that 22% of them did not have full success with toileting.Research studies on toileting in autism have been scarce and are mainly single … phi weather

WebApr 2, 2024 · •Similar to urination training, identify ONE STRONG reinforcer •Prompt/take your child to the toilet 20 minutes prior to the time they are likely to have a bowel movement •Have child sit on toilet for alternating 5-10 minute periods in between sitting and breaks. •Verbal interactions on toilet consist of: •Friendly reminders

When a parent/caregiver is ready to begin the process of toilet training, it’s important to agree on some basic facets and make a plan: 1. “Sit for Six”. Make it a point to spend time sitting on the toilet or on a child-sized floor potty six times per day.
